# Android VideoView视频不满问题解决方案 ## 引言 在Android开发中,使用VideoView组件来播放视频是非常常见的需求。然而,有时候视频在VideoView中的显示可能会出现不满的问题,即视频的宽高比与VideoView的宽高比不匹配,导致视频显示不完整。本文将详细介绍这个问题的原因,并给出一种解决方案。 ## 问题原因 VideoView是Android提供
原创 2023-12-05 17:13:11
680阅读
一、form-generator是什么?✨ ⭐️ ? form-generator的作者是这样介绍的:Element UI表单设计及代码生成器,可将生成的代码直接运行在基于Element的vue项目中;也可导出JSON表单,使用配套的解析器将JSON解析成真实的表单。但form-generator提供组件并不能满足我们在项目中的使用,比如表格组件,el-table,子表单等等,在很多项目
一个好的深度学习模型的目标是将训练数据很好地推广到问题领域的任何数据。这使我们可以对模型从未见过的数据进行将来的预测。 首先,当模型泛化性差的时候,我们需要找到其原因,当训练集能够很好地拟合,但是测试集却不能有很好的准确率,主要可能有以下几点原因:网络足够大,仅仅记住了所有样本当网络足够大时,无论你的数据集多么没规律,多么无意义,网络都能记住它们。 如果你的数据集巨大,但是模型仅在训练集上表现良好
iphone开发学习,iphone5页面适配修改 1.需要添加一张启动图片,大小:640*1136,添加后默认命名为Default-568h@2x.png。图片适配,对于高清的1136图片,命名同样使用@2x,只是改名图片名称,如image-1-os5.png,image-1-os5@2x.png,在代码中判断iphone5?(image-1):(image-1-os5),没有@22x这
在使用 Android Compose 开发应用时,很多开发者在显示对话框(Dialog)时发现其宽度没有占满屏幕的情况,导致用户体验不佳。本文将通过版本对比、迁移指南、兼容性处理、实战案例、排错指南、以及性能优化等多个方面,详细描述如何解决这个问题。 ### 版本对比 首先,我们来看看 Android Compose 的不同版本中对 Dialog 宽度处理的特性差异。在早期版本中,Dialo
原创 5月前
193阅读
 Android VideoView实现播放本地和网络视频,滑动快进快退、滑动调整音量和调整亮度,分享功能,进度显示,双击暂停,单击暂停等功能原生VideoView控件的实现,可自定义布局,类似直播的播放界面:一.效果图:    二.功能列表:1、打开本地媒体器,SeekBar滑动进度条,暂停/播放按钮三个功能; 2、锁定按钮功能;3、分
转载 2023-11-21 16:26:02
113阅读
# Android VideoView设置跳转静音 ![video]( ## 介绍 在开发Android应用程序时,经常会遇到需要在视频中进行跳转的情况。VideoView是Android提供的一个用于播放视频的视图组件,它可以方便地实现视频的播放和控制。本文将介绍如何使用VideoView实现视频跳转功能,并设置跳转时静音。 ## VideoView简介 VideoView是一个继承自
原创 2023-09-19 08:39:07
81阅读
[size=large]学习Android开发已经几天了,虽然与之前的学习内容有所不同,但我感觉这个很有趣,很多东西还是与之前的一样,就是改了名字,改了一些方法,至少,编程思想还是不变的。 最重要的是Activity Activity类就类似于之前用过的JFrame类,一个Activity就是一个单独的幕, Activity中有若干个View(控件
转载 2024-09-05 20:48:51
15阅读
1. 文字的水平居中 将一段文字置于容器的水平中点,只要设置text-align属性即可:   text-align:center; 2. 容器的水平居中 先为该容器设置一个明确宽度,然后将margin的水平值设为auto即可。   div#container {     width:760px;     margin:0 auto;   } 3. 文字的垂直居
转载 2024-08-21 10:44:40
44阅读
用Tiled工具可以快速制作关卡地图,但是,与很多国内的游戏引擎(Cocos/Egret等)不同,Unity天生并不支持Tiled,官方说的要支持,也迟迟没有发布。于是,就催生了很多第三方的Tiled for Unity 库。在网上搜 Tiled Unity,收费与不收费的可以找到很多。其中,排名第一的Tiled2Unity是非常有特色的一个。优点完全开源,完全免费。自动合并图块为Mesh与很多别
转载 2024-10-23 22:34:34
250阅读
说到flex布局,大家可能并不陌生。对于基本概念,大家应该也有所了解。这里可以推荐我看过的认为比较通俗易懂的博客,它就是阮一峰老师的flex布局博客, 感谢阮一峰老师的无私分享。那么,了解过基本概念后。对于Flex布局我们常见的几个误区和经常遇到的所谓的坑是什么呢?这里,兼容性问题我就不讲了,不是本次博客的主要内容。下面我主要想讲讲flex布局使用的几个误区和常遇到的问题。1. Flex属性的写法
导读:「以客户为中心,技术为产品服务」是爱番番线索管家团队一贯遵循的原则。技术架构规划首先应该围绕业务诉求展开,用合理的技术赋能产品,产品在不断的演进中又对技术提出更高的标准和要求。作为爱番番PV最高的页面,本文将详细介绍线索列表如何从快速交付的刀耕火种原始状态,逐步走向“高可用、高质量、高体验“的成熟期。全文9355字,预计阅读时间24分钟。在后台系统中,列表是最常见的数据展示方式之一,它就像系
刚好在用到原生TabLayout的时候碰到了这个小问题,网上很多文章都很多余,其实很简单,分享大家看一下<android.support.design.widget.TabLayout android:id="@+id/tab_layout"
原创 2022-02-18 16:09:26
681阅读
 主要解决思路:获取图表节点的父级节点宽度然后赋值给图表节点,父级节点可设置成自适应宽度,然后再modal渲染图标一定要注意节点渲染顺序,最后通过浏览器窗口的resize()事件与echarts的resize()方法来结合控制图表大小 以UI框架iview为例,element同理,当我们在使用echarts图表时很多情况下宽度都不是固定,这时我们可能会想到用百分比来解决,然后实
在Android开发中,有时我们会遇到一个常见问题:ScrollView下的LinearLayout没有填满屏幕的高度。这不仅影响了用户的体验,也可能导致用户在交互时的困惑。本文将详细记录解决这一问题的过程,包括背景分析、错误现象的识别、根因分析、解决方案的制定及验证等过程。 ### 问题背景 在开发一款社交应用时,页面的排版在用户体验中占据了重要地位。特定的功能需求要求使用ScrollVie
1.使用OpenCV并进行人脸检测参考前文,即可完成横屏的人脸检测,地址如下: Android OpenCV使用2_使用OpenCV并进行人脸检测 2.横屏转竖屏研究旋转预览获取到的Mat,关键代码MatRotate.matRotateClockWise270(mRgba,mRgba);//openCV预览界面监听 mOpenCvCameraView.setCvCameraView
# JavaScript截取视频不满意点击 ## 引言 随着互联网的快速发展,视频已经成为人们日常生活中不可或缺的一部分。然而,有时我们可能会遇到一些视频不满意点击的情况,这时就需要使用JavaScript来截取视频并进行处理。本文将介绍如何使用JavaScript来截取视频并展示相关的代码示例。 ## 准备工作 在开始使用JavaScript来截取视频之前,我们需要准备一些必要的工作:
原创 2023-09-28 02:57:33
57阅读
2019年可谓是可折叠硬件“元年”。在人们还在热议可折叠手机的时候,可折叠电脑也来了。可折叠电脑ThinkPadX15月13日,联想在美国奥兰多召开的Transform3.0@Accelerate大会上展示了一台13.3英寸屏幕的可折叠屏电脑原型机ThinkPadX1。外观和配置。ThinkPadX1尽管仍然处于原型机阶段,但其完成度已经相当高。其外观上最引人瞩目之处,是其采用了柔性可折叠屏。它采
转载 2024-01-17 11:24:26
132阅读
目录1.概述2.图解表格布局中的常用术语和概念2.1 表格布局有哪些属性2.2 Margin(边距)2.3 Spacing(间隔) 2.4 Strech(纵向和横向拉伸系数)2.5 最小行高与最小列宽2.6 SizeConstraint(尺寸控制模式)3.基础用法3.1 使用Qt设计师创建布局3.2 使用代码创建布局GridLayoutTest.h GridLayoutTest
1路实时视频200w像素大概2M带宽
  • 1
  • 2
  • 3
  • 4
  • 5